> I'm attempting to use MPICH to manage a number of non-MPI processes.    
> The latter call system() and fork(), which as I understand it may  
> cause undefined behavior if they were spawned as MPI processes.   How 
> do I use
> MPI_Comm_spawn() to launch these processes?
> 
> For example, OpenMpi has a key for the "info" field named 
> "ompi_non_mpi", which causes a non-MPI process to be spawned.   Is 
> there something similar in MPICH?
